You might try piecing a background... maybe in similar colors... and then adding a fusible piece on top. For instance... if you pieced some blues, maybe some greens or browns at the bottom and then fused a flower on top. It could be a fun starter for you. You could practice some free-motion stitching to secure the flower down, add some hand stitching if you like... whatever. You decide. That's part of what makes it "art."

Work small at first... basically studies, maybe 5x7, just to try a few things out and see what you might like. There are some great videos to watch, as well, that can teach you techniques. Have you taken a look at Quilting Arts magazine? It's a great resource.
